Russia has faced nearly 29,000 sanctions.

According to data from the independent analysis agency Castellum and publicly available information, the number of sanctions imposed on Russia since 2014 has reached nearly 29,000, with the most restrictions coming from the United States, Canada, and Switzerland. As of the end of April 2025, foreign entities have imposed approximately 28,937 non-trade sanctions on Russia. Among them, 92% were sanctions implemented since the end of February 2022. The United States has imposed the most restrictions, accounting for 25.5% of the total number of sanctions imposed by various countries, followed by Canada at 12.6% and Switzerland at 11.3%.
